Glassy Text Effect


In this tutorial you will learn how to give text a glassy look, as shown below:img

 

Step 1

In Photoshop, we will create a new document, use the settings below.

Step 2

Fill your document with some text, I used Segoe which comes with Windows Media Center. Make sure to use these text settings.

Step 3

Right click on your text layer, select Blending Options, and apply these settings.

Step 4

This step is optional, but you might want to add some color to your text, I used Blue and Green.

Step 5

Now we are going to add some â??glossâ?? to our text. Start off by right clicking on the layer preview image. Now click on select layer transparency.

Step 6

Select a Marquee tool, I chose the Elliptical tool, now while holding down the Alt key, select a portion of the marching ants to remove.

Step 7

Create a new layer, and fill the selected area with white (#FFFFFF).

Step 8

Turn down the opacity on the white layer to around 21%. This is your end result.
